![]() Hello, I have a table that has a somewhat complex arrangement of borders which divide the table into groups of cells. At the moment those (irregular) borders are white, and I'd like to change them the black. I know I can change the pen color to black and that will help me create new black border.... but how can I change the color of my existing white table borders? Thnaks! Jay |

Select the cell)s) to change. Set the pen to Black and then in Borders set to ALL (or whatever is needed)
